Job Description

Senior Product Engineer designing and building financial workflows across the stack. Collaborating with the team to shape architecture and deliver user experiences.

Responsibilities:

  • Own and ship full-stack features end-to-end, from shaping early ideas to delivering production systems used by customers daily
  • Build complex, data-dense interfaces — review queues, journal entry editors, reconciliation workflows, agent-state visualization, financial reports — that don't break under real customer data
  • Use AI tooling as your primary mode of writing code - Claude Code, Codex, or equivalent. AI does most of the implementation work under your direction; you own architecture, decomposition, verification, and review. Push back when AI gets it wrong — taste and judgment are why you're here, not raw typing speed.
  • Architect backend services and APIs that handle sensitive financial data with high standards for performance, security, and data integrity
  • Build clean, fast, and intuitive frontend experiences that translate complex financial concepts into simple user workflows
  • Make pragmatic technical decisions balancing speed, quality, and long-term maintainability without over-engineering
  • Debug and resolve production issues across the stack; improve observability and system resilience over time
  • Identify and address performance bottlenecks, scaling challenges, and areas of technical debt
  • Collaborate closely with product and design to shape roadmap and deliver meaningful user outcomes
  • Help define how we build by contributing to code quality, architecture decisions, and team practices
  • Mentor other engineers and raise the bar through thoughtful feedback and hands-on support

Requirements:

  • 7+ years shipping production software, with at least 3 years in modern web stacks (React, TypeScript, Node, Python)
  • Demonstrable AI-augmented engineering chops. You've actually shipped meaningful work with Claude Code / Cursor / Codex at the wheel, and can articulate what you delegate vs. what you own
  • A track record of shipping at startup pace, with strong opinions about scope, sequence, and what's worth building
  • Comfort working across the stack, including infrastructure and data layers
  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, or similar)
  • Strong product instincts. You think about user impact, not just implementation
  • Ability to operate independently and make sound decisions in a fast-moving, low-structure environment
  • Clear communicator who collaborates well across disciplines
